Celebrate the most joyous of seasons with these original stories of holiday romance from five of today's most beloved award-winning Regency authors. Each tale is set on Christmas Eve, capturing the season's true spirit of charity and goodwill, proving time and again why love is the greatest gift of all. This special collection is a perfect present for friends and lovers who find themselves looking forward to the holiday with delicious anticipation, wondering what awaits them under the tree--and under the mistletoe ....

Little Miracles – Barbara Metzger
Two rodents try to save a church by sharing a secret only they remember, while bringing love and happiness to the vicar and the local lord.

Marriage Stakes - Allison Lane
Miss Sophie Landess is returning home with her widowed and very pregnant sister when they have a carriage accident and are saved by the Earl of Westlake. Soon, Sophie finds herself helping him finding the right bride after they are invited to stay at his home during the holiday season.

The Gift of the Spoons – Nancy Butler
A man, desperate to save his son, goes in search of a healer he has heard about, but finds her daughter instead. The enmity between the two is immediate, but she eventually agrees to go and see his son leading to healing the rift between father and son and the developing of warmer feelings between the two.-

The Reckless Miss Ripley – Diane Farr
A hero finds himself helping Miss Claudia Ripley reach Bath safely. A humorous and warm romance

The Christmas Thief – Edith Layton
The hero, a former captain in the army, believes to hae lost all his fortune due to an embezzler and tries his best to arrange a happy Christmas for his niece, even if the means stealing a doll or pawning his hat and boots. He also frees his fiancée from their commitment due to his financial situation. but will they have a happily ever after? [Aneca-Goodreads]
